Ghayl Bā Wazīr weather in January

In January, Ghayl Bā Wazīr sees average daytime highs of 27°C and overnight lows near 18°C, with 5 mm of rain across 1.2 wet days and about 11.2 hours of daylight. It is the 12th-warmest and 8th-wettest month of the year here.

Day-to-day highs hold fairly steady near 27°C through the month.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 66% of the time in January, and the air most often feels humid.

Daylight stretches from about 11 h 06 min at the start of January to 11 h 18 min by month's end. Set against the rest of the year, January is Ghayl Bā Wazīr's 10th-clearest and 5th-windiest month. For the whole year in context, see Ghayl Bā Wazīr's year-round climate.

Location & terrain

Where is Ghayl Bā Wazīr?

Ghayl Bā Wazīr sits at 14.8°N, 49.4°E, 87 m above sea level, in Yemen. The nearest listed city is Mukalla, 37 km away.

Topography around Ghayl Bā Wazīr

How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 3, 16 and 80 km of Ghayl Bā Wazīr.

Within 3 km, the terrain around Ghayl Bā Wazīr has only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 76 m around an average of 90 m above sea level; within 16 km, large vari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 993 m; within 80 km, very signific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 2,142 m.

The land around Ghayl Bā Wazīr is covered by bare terrain (78%) within 3 km, bare terrain (90%) within 16 km, and bare terrain (72%) and water (27%) within 80 km.
